Hollow (Member) born St. Louis, Missouri, July 8, 1940; admitted to bar, 1964, Tennessee; 1971, U.S. Court of Appeals, Sixth Circuit and U.S. Supreme Court. Education: University of Tennessee (J.D., 1964). Phi Alpha Delta; Kappa Tau Alpha. Co-Author: with Rudolph L. Ennis, "Tennessee Sunshine: The People's Business Goes Public," 42 Tennessee Law Review 527, 1975. Author: "A Compilation of Tennessee Sunshine Cases 1974-1994," Tennessee Press Publications; "A Review of Closed RecordsThe Shell of T.C.A. 10-7-503," Tennessee Hot Line Publication, 1996. Lecturer, Entertainment Law Symposium, University of Tennessee, College of Law, 1987-1988. Listed in: Best Lawyers in America, Communications Law, 1995; Best 101 Lawyers in Tennessee, 2004 and 2005. Law Clerk, Chief Justice, Tennessee Supreme Court, 1964. Deputy Law Director, City of Knoxville, 1965-1967. Instructor and Staff Attorney, Legal Clinic, University of Tennessee, College of Law, 1967-1969. Assistant District Attorney, 3rd Judicial Circuit, State of Tennessee, 1971-1974. Associate Professor, Communications Law, University of Tennessee, 1970-1988. Founder, Tennessee First Amendment Hot Line, 1992. Member: Knoxville (President, 1987) and Tennessee (Member, Communications Law and Litigation Sections; Co-Chairman, Commission on Jury Reform) Bar Associations; American Inns of Court (Master of the Bench).
